BOYCE McADAMS, JR.

TOWNVILLE - Boyce McAdams, Jr., 82, of Townville, widower of the late Edna Harbin McAdams, died Sunday, September 26, 2010 at Seneca Health & Rehabilitation Center.

Born November 20, 1927 in Anderson County, he was the son of the late Samuel Boyce and Elsie Martin McAdams. He was a retired insurance salesman and was a member of the Townville Masonic Lodge and Double Springs Baptist Church.

He was a loving father and papa to one son, Steve McAdams (Sandra) of Townville; four daughters, Jean Staughton (Richard) of Acworth, GA, Sheila Williams (David) of Pinehurst, NC, Lynn King (Teddy) of Townville, and Sherry Owens (Wally) of Anderson; seven grandchildren; eight great-grandchildren; two brothers, Jim McAdams of Townville, and Ray McAdams of Gaffney; and four sisters, Hazel Ramage of Townville, Margaret Burdette of Pendleton, Mary Vaughn of Possum Kingdom, and Linda Wright of Bennettsville.

In addition to his wife and parents, he was preceded in death by a son, Tim McAdams, a brother, Gary McAdams, and a sister, Willie Sue Williams. 

Funeral services will be held at 3 p.m. Tuesday at Oakdale Baptist Church conducted by Rev. David Blizzard and Rev. David Walters. Burial will be in the church cemetery. The family will receive friends from 6 until 8 p.m. Monday at Sullivan-King Mortuary, Northeast Chapel, 3205 North Highway 81, Anderson. The family is at the home of Sherry and Wally Owens, 124 Burns Bridge Circle, Anderson. The body will be placed in the church at 2 p.m. Tuesday.

Flowers will be accepted, or memorials may be made to the Oakdale Baptist Church Building Fund in memory of Boyce McAdams, Jr., 6724 Highway 24, Townville, SC 29689.
